  1. So after talking w/ MSi I was able to get a Beta Bios that solves this issue. Here are the steps to get the NVMe m.2 raid going and become bootable. 1. You need to make a folder and put the beta bios inside it. I named my folder Beta Bios. 2. Put the folder on a USB drive and flash the motherboards Bios with the new "Beta Bios" 3. Do the steps in the first video "MSI® HOW-TO Setup X399 NVME M.2 RAID." If you like Destiny 2 then come follow me at bit.ly/GW0311 Attached to this is the beta bios file. E7B09AMS.168
